Technical Specifications and Workflow Efficiency

From a technical standpoint, flexibility is everything. A designer cannot afford to be limited by file formats. The description notes that This pack contains ➤ 1 SVG files perfectly designed for Cricut and Silhouette Studio ➤ 1 PNG files transparent background ➤ 1 EPS files for editing purposes ➤ 1 JPEG files for Iron On Machines ➤ 1 DXF. While these formats suggest a strong focus on print-on-demand and crafting, the inclusion of SVG and PNG files makes this a robust asset for web use as well.

The SVG format is particularly important for web developers and designers because it scales infinitely without losing quality. This means you can use this graphic in a responsive website header, and it will look crisp on a large desktop monitor and a small smartphone screen alike. The PNG with a transparent background allows for seamless layering over different color schemes, ensuring your website header or sidebar widgets maintain your chosen palette. The EPS file offers further editing capabilities for those who wish to tweak colors or shapes before deployment, ensuring the final output matches your exact modern design standards.

Practical Publisher Notes for Implementation

Before integrating this asset into your live site, follow these practical steps to ensure optimal performance and compliance:

  1. Test Across Devices: Preview the graphic on desktop, tablet, and mobile screens. Ensure it does not break the layout or obscure navigation elements.
  2. Check Contrast and Readability: Place headline text over or beside the graphic. Use tools to verify that the contrast ratio meets accessibility standards. Text must remain readable against all background variations.
  3. Font Pairing Review: Experiment with pairing the graphic with different typefaces. Try it next to a script font for elegance, or a bold display font for impact. Find the combination that reinforces your small business branding.
  4. Optimize File Size: Even vector-based designs can have heavy code. Export your web-ready versions (PNG/JPEG) with proper compression to maintain fast page load times. Speed is a ranking factor and essential for user retention.
  5. Verify Commercial Licensing: Always confirm your commercial license before using the asset on monetized websites, affiliate pages, or paid content products. Ensure you are allowed to modify the design if necessary.
